God of War Mod Will Let You Play As Atreus

If you've ever played as the God of War himself and thought, "I'd much rather be playing as this man's whiny son," then boy, do we have good news for you - a new mod that is in the works will let you take charge of Atreus and his bow.

Thanks to Santa Monica Studio's blessing for players to take over the game and go nuts with mods. And in that spirit, a modder by the name of Speclizer, has started work on a mod that will let you play as Atreus, dipping and darting around foes and firing arrows as the main form of attack.

The video posted that reveals the work-in-progress mod shows Atreus in action and taking on Baldur in Kratos' first encounter with him.

Though the mod is still burdened with some strange animations, once completed it's likely to be incredibly sleek - so we're looking forward to seeing the final product.

Will God of War: Ragnarok Come To PC?

It's not known yet if the upcoming God of War: Ragnarok will come to PC or not, but given the first game's move from PlayStation, it's likely to happen at some point. It took three years for God of War to make the jump, so maybe we shouldn't expect the port to be made right away, but it'd be a surprise if by the end of the 2020s, only the first of two God of War titles have been ported. So perhaps taking Atreus over into Ragnarok isn't such a bizarre hope after all.
